What way to Wire subs

I was looking on the net, and found this pic. Series, or Paralle.
What would be the proper one to hook up my 2 Infinity 1250w Subs.
I want to get a 2 channel amp aswell.

youre subs are svc 4ohms each so neither........
Do youreself a favour and get a mono subamp thats stable at 2 ohms and just hook the subs to it the traditional way and you will be good to go. two channel amp will not be good for youre subs impendence.
